On Wed, 2002-03-06 at 17:48, Matthijs van der Klip wrote: > Hi, > > Could someone tell me what the status of the 'null' issue is?: > > http://oss.sgi.com/projects/xfs/faq.html#nulls > > > Has any solution or workaround been developed yet? Can we expect a > solution in the next official release? > The 2.4.18 kernel in cvs and the patches has some code which removes the synchronous transactions from xfs. For the most part these tended to be the culprit in that an inode size update was forced out into the log long before the data was. So, while it is still possible, it is less likely than it was.
